Information on Tenancy Rights (British Columbia)

 

In British Columbia, rental housing is governed by the Residential Tenancy Act (RTA). Students should understand their legal rights and responsibilities before signing a rental agreement.

Rights for Tenants in BC

  • Tenants have the right to safe, clean, and habitable accommodation.
  • Landlords must provide a written tenancy agreement.
  • Rent increases must follow BC government guidelines and notice periods.
  • Landlords cannot enter the unit without proper notice.
  • Damage deposits are regulated and cannot exceed half of one month’s rent.
  • Tenants cannot be evicted without lawful notice and valid legal grounds.

Safety Tips for Renting in Vancouver

 

Rental Listings

  • Visit any property in person before paying deposits.
  • Avoid sending money through insecure transfer methods (crypto, gift cards).
  • Use official RTB tenancy agreement forms.
  • Be cautious of unusually low rent prices or landlords refusing to meet.
